The Kenton Portland Farmers” Market is a vibrant outdoor marketplace located in Portland, OR, operating from June through September. Visitors can enjoy a wide variety of fresh, locally-sourced produce including fruits, vegetables, herbs, and cut flowers. The market also features specialty items such as canned goods, dry beans, eggs, honey, and non-poultry meats, along with beverages like wine, spirits, beer, and hard cider. With its lively atmosphere, it serves as a hub for community members, chefs, and tourists seeking farm-fresh ingredients and unique local products. Open on Wednesdays from 3 to 7 pm, the market is a popular destination for those looking to support local farmers and artisans while enjoying the best of Portland”s agricultural bounty.
